What if the future of leadership isn’t about having the right answers—but asking better questions? In this episode of Kraftpodden, Jenny Bergh, MCC sits down with Zubair Ahmed, leadership development expert at Telenor, to explore what it really means to lead in a world defined by constant change, AI disruption, and increasing uncertainty. We dive into the shift from knowledge to curiosity, from external performance to inner development, and why leaders today must focus less on tools and frameworks, and more on human intelligence, empathy, and self-awareness.
Zubair shares powerful insights on why stability is a myth, how adaptability is the real skill of the future, and why cultivating your inner world may be the most important leadership practice of all. If you’re navigating change, leading others, or simply trying to make sense of today’s complexity, this conversation will challenge how you think, lead, and grow. This is not just about leadership.
